Understanding Today's Crossword Puzzle

The clue "Fed. cryptographer hirer" points to the answer "NSA" for several reasons:

  1. The term "Fed." often refers to a federal government agency in crossword puzzles.
  2. "Cryptographer hirer" suggests an organization that would employ individuals skilled in code-making and code-breaking, often associated with intelligence agencies.
  3. Putting these clues together leads to the National Security Agency (NSA), a federal agency known for its cryptography and signals intelligence work.
In conclusion, "NSA" fits the clue by indicating a federal agency that employs cryptographers, making it the correct answer in today's puzzle.
